If you operate a QSR chain aiming to automate drive-thru orders and boost revenue via upselling, Presto Voice is your purpose-built tool — evidenced by recent partnerships like Dairy Queen. For non-programmers building custom AI agents or optimizing prompts across modalities (text, image, video), YiVal offers a flexible, no-code platform with freemium entry. Choose Presto Voice for drive-thru automation ROI; choose YiVal for general GenAI app development.

Who should pick which

  • QSR chain operator
    Pick: Presto Voice

    Presto Voice is built for drive-thru automation with proven upselling results (e.g., Taco John's) and integrates with POS/headset systems.

  • Non-programmer building a custom AI agent
    Pick: YiVal

    YiVal lets you create agents via plain English, no code required, and supports multimodal inputs for diverse tasks.

  • Enterprise needing compliant AI dev
    Pick: YiVal

    YiVal emphasizes safety and privacy (health data roots) and offers version control and one-click reports for governance.

  • Franchise network scaling drive-thru AI
    Pick: Presto Voice

    Presto Voice supports multi-location deployment with menu unification and minimal disruption.

Can YiVal be used for drive-thru voice automation?

No, YiVal is a general GenAI platform for prompt engineering and agent creation; it lacks drive-thru-specific integrations like POS or headset systems.

Does Presto Voice support video or image inputs?

No, Presto Voice is focused on audio (voice) for drive-thru and phone ordering; it does not support image or video processing.

Is YiVal free to use?

YiVal offers a freemium model with a free tier; paid plans provide additional features and usage limits.

What recent partnerships does Presto Voice have?

In April 2026, Dairy Queen partnered with Presto to use its Voice AI for drive-thru automation.

Which tool is better for non-programmers?

YiVal is explicitly designed for non-programmers with no-code, plain English goal setting and agent creation.
